  5. ThisGameIsSucky Win User

    status code: 807b0193

    I looked it up and the support page,
    https://support.xbox.com/en-US/xbox-360/xbox-live/error-code-807b0193
    ,came back with the exact same steps you listed out. Reading ahead into it the phrase "Error 807b0193 occurs when you try to download you Xbox Live profile." So, this may mean that the
    Netflix app on the Xbox 360 is having trouble reading your account information and not exactly the Xbox itself. Try to uninstall or reinstall the Netflix app after waiting a bit and see what happens when you boot it back up/log back in. Alternatively, the
    troubleshooter does simply recommend waiting... so you may not get to watch Netflix for a few hours. If you've confirmed all services are up and you are connected to Xbox Live then the waiting game is what you'll have to play.

    Here's the link to the Netflix for Xbox 360 troubleshooter just in case, https://support.xbox.com/en-US/xbox-360/apps/netflix-on-xbox-info

  7. AwesomePlayer27 Win User

    Netflix signs me out of Live while loading.

    Try this. I did not make up this method I got it from someone.

    1

    Power on your Xbox 360 and press the guide button (The X button in the center) on the Xbox 360 controller to bring up the menu. Then navigate to the "Settings" blade on the left side of the menu. Use the control stick to scroll down and select "System Settings."
    Then press A.

    2

    Select "Memory" from the menu, followed by "Hard Drive" and finally "Games."

    A list will populate with all your saved data. Scroll through the list and delete all entries that have the word "Netflix" attached to them. This effectively deletes your account on the Xbox 360.

    3

    Log in to the Netflix account associated with your Xbox 360 console (using a computer) and select "Netflix Ready Device Activation" from your "Account" page. Then choose the Xbox 360. Once you have selected the Xbox 360, use the "deactivate" function to
    remove the link between your console and the Netflix account.

    4

    Find the Xbox Live marketplace (on your Xbox 360) and download the Netflix instant queue streaming utility. Once the application has been downloaded, launch it from the dashboard.

    5

    Go back to Netflix on your computer and log in to the new account you want to use on your Xbox 360. Go back to the "Netflix Ready Device Activation" section and add the Xbox 360. You will receive an activation code.
